Can EWOT Therapy improve athletic performance?

EWOT (Exercise with Oxygen Therapy) involves breathing higher levels of oxygen during exercise to potentially enhance performance and recovery. But can it boost athletic ability?

Understanding EWOT Therapy

EWOT typically involves using an EWOT bag or kit, which delivers concentrated oxygen to the body during physical activity. The idea is to increase oxygen delivery to the muscles, potentially improving endurance and recovery.

Potential Benefits for Athletes

  1. Enhanced Oxygen Delivery: By breathing higher levels of oxygen, athletes may experience improved oxygen saturation in the blood, allowing muscles to perform better during exercise.
  2. Increased Endurance: With more oxygen available, athletes might be able to sustain higher levels of exertion for longer periods, leading to enhanced endurance.
  3. Faster Recovery: Oxygen is crucial for muscle recovery. EWOT therapy may facilitate quicker recovery times between workouts, reducing muscle soreness and fatigue.

Considerations

  1. Individual Variances: Responses to EWOT therapy may vary among athletes. What works for one person may not yield the same results for another.
  2. Professional Guidance: Athletes should seek guidance from qualified professionals before incorporating EWOT therapy into their training regimen. Proper usage and dosage are crucial for safety and effectiveness.

Conclusion

EWOT therapy holds promise as a potential tool for enhancing athletic performance. While anecdotal evidence is positive, more scientific research is necessary to fully understand its effects. Athletes interested in trying EWOT should approach it with caution and consult with experts to maximize benefits while minimizing risks.
